Last night was the first night of Taylor Swift's Reputation tour, which promises to be one of the summer's big pop spectacles. Swift played at the University Of Phoenix Stadium in Glendale, Arizona, and as previously announced, she brought along Charli XCX and Camila Cabello as openers.

The Starting Line: Patti Smith, The , & American Pie’s Alyson Hannigan React To Taylor Swift’s Tortured Poets Namechecks
submitted by Nick Apr 21st 2024 07:00 pm (www.stereogum.com)
Taylor Swift’s new double-album The Tortured Poets Department came out on Friday, and it’s full of namechecks. On the title track, the pop star mentions rock legend Patti Smith; on “The Black Dog,” she summons pop-punk band the Starting Line. Both acts have shared their reactions.
